    Tui

    Just saw a Tui in the garden. These birds have always lived around Wellington but were always very rare. In recent years there has been a resurgence, particularly in the western suburbs. I’ve heard them singing over the last few weeks, but it was great to finally see one drinking nectar out of the flax.

    Webstock

    Alright alright alright – party at the moon tower! Well, the Wellington Town Hall anyway. Yep, Webstock has been announced and will happen in Wellington next May 23rd to 26th. This is going to be a great conference – more than a conference, a party too. We’ve got some great speakers coming, including Joel “on Software” Spolsky, Ben “lead developer of Firefox” Goodger, Doug “the designer” Bowman, Kelly Goto, Kathy Sierra, Dori Smith, Steve Champeon, Joe Clarke, and other really really cool people. More details at the site, and plenty more announcements coming up between now and then.
